REVENUE MEMORANDUM CIRCULAR (RMC) NO. 97 2021

Posted by on February 19th, 2022

This issuance covers the tax liability of social media influencers, allowable deductions, tax compliance, and effects of taxes withheld in other countries of which they can opt to report under EITR (8% Income Tax Rate), 40% OSD (Optional Standard Deduction), and GITR (Graduated Income Tax Rate) regime.
